Chipmaker Renesas halts Beijing plant as COVID spreads

Japan’s Renesas Electronics has suspended work at its Beijing chip plant because of COVID-19 infections and will keep it closed for several days.
Renesas semiconductorRenesas, the world’s leading maker of automobile chips, halted the factory on Friday. The plant mostly produces semiconductors used in industrial machinery and home appliances.

The chipmaker will be able to make up for the lost output with existing stock and does not expect much of an impact from the stoppage, a spokesperson said.

Renesas, which makes around a third of all the microcontroller chips used by the world’s carmakers, is one of many big Japanese manufacturers to have operations in China. It also has a plant in the eastern city of Suzhou.
